Traditional Mosquito Control Methods: An Overview
Below is a clear, fact-based look at the most common traditional mosquito control methods and how they perform in real conditions.
Sprays & Fogging
Sprays and fogging involve releasing insecticides into the air or onto surfaces.
-
Effectiveness: Fast knockdown of adult mosquitoes; typically lasts 24–72 hours.
-
Limitations: No impact on eggs or larvae. Populations rebound quickly.
-
Concerns: Chemical exposure, drift into sensitive areas, and growing insecticide resistance.
Electric Zappers
Zappers use UV lights to attract insects and then eliminate them.
-
Effectiveness: Studies show under 5% of insects killed are mosquitoes.
-
Limitations: Mosquitoes are not strongly attracted to UV light.
-
Concerns: Kills beneficial insects and may disrupt local ecosystems.
Coils & Topical Repellents
Repellents and coils offer personal protection but do not reduce mosquito populations.
-
Effectiveness: Works for 4–8 hours depending on the product.
-
Limitations: Only effective in close proximity.
-
Concerns: Indoor coils release smoke and particulates similar to cigarette exposure.
